I31 (Other diseases of pericardium) compared with S26 (Injury of heart), from the official CMS tabular data. Do not report these codes together: the official tabular list marks them Excludes1.
Can these codes be reported together?
No — do not report together. I31 carries an Excludes1 note covering S26: “traumatic injury to pericardium (S26.-)”
Sole exception: when the two conditions are documented as unrelated to each other (ICD-10-CM Official Guidelines, Section I.A.12.a).
